Abstract

1,144,564. Boots &c. CLARKS Ltd. 7 June, 1966 [10 March, 1965], No. 10259/65. Heading A3B. In a method of making a shoe the upper 1 is cut with straight back-seam edges 6, 7 which are closed by the use of adhesive or by sewing and then rounded or bulged to fit the heel. The corresponding edges 8, 9 of the two parts 10, 11 of a heel stiffener and the edges of the lining are also cut straight. A toe puff 12 and a lining 13 are placed on the cut upper which is then folded to a near closed position in which the topline 21 is given any required treatment e.g. skiving, channelling and folding. The upper assembly is then located on a jigging frame by means of pins engaging in holes or slits 20 and the back seam of the upper closed by sewing or cementing. A suitable cement is one based on a two part polyurethane and tri-isocyanate mix which may be set by heating by high frequency means when under pressure. After closing the back seam of the upper the stiffener parts 10, 11 are joined by bonding and any decorative stitching required is applied. The final operation is shaping the straight back by treating the shoe with steam and moulding in one or two stages. The method of making shoes according to the invention results in a saving of leather (Fig. 5) the amount lying between a straight line 30 and a curved line 29 being saved. The leather of the upper may be stretched (Fig. 5) to obtain an additional saving of leather.
